Norsk hydro is one of the world's largest aluminum producers. Some 35,000 employees were locked out of the company's network, and hydro had to shut down several manufacturing plants in europe and the u.s. Last march, aluminum supplier norsk hydro was attacked by lockergoga, a form of ransomware.
